Today's prayer times for Felizzano, Italy are calculated using precise astronomical data via the Offline Calculation (Adhan) method. Fajr begins at 04:26 and ends at sunrise (06:23), giving approximately 117 minutes for the pre-dawn prayer. Isha starts at 22:28.
Tahajjud time in Felizzano today is 01:52. Tahajjud is the voluntary night prayer performed in the final third of the night, between Isha (22:28) and the beginning of Fajr (04:26). Islamic midnight in Felizzano is 00:34.
Qibla direction from Felizzano is 122° (SE) from North. Suhoor must be completed before Imsak at 04:26, and Iftar begins at Maghrib (20:39).
